3. Horizon 7.0 AT Treadmill

The Horizon 7.0 AT treadmill is an excellent option for those looking to add more running-related workouts to their gym at home. It has a large, durable deck, speedy motor, and interval training workout content. The cushioning system with three zones is a nice feature for new runners that allow them to exercise without worrying about injury to their joints or knees. The 7.0 AT also includes eight workouts built-in, making it easy to find an exercise no matter your fitness level. This machine is also a great value for less than $1,000.

This treadmill is the very first in Horizon's Studio Series, a line of treadmills that are specifically designed for streaming classes. It may not have a big TV-like display or a proprietary streaming application, but it has plenty to offer all levels of runners. It's designed to last and features an extremely powerful 3.0 CHP motor. Additionally, it comes with a lifetime warranty on the frame and motor, which is rare for treadmills.

The 7.0 AT is Bluetooth compatible which means you can connect it to popular training apps. This lets you stream Peloton and Nike Run Club to enjoy exercises led by trainers. It's not tied to any content subscription, which is nice for a machine in this price range.

Another big bonus of this treadmill is its foldability which is helpful in the event that you don't have a lot of extra space to devote to your treadmill. The deck folds easily into a compact unit, and it comes with a hydraulic assist that lowers the deck when you push down on a lever underneath the console. The resultant footprint is 48 inches long, shrinking its size by 36%. This is an excellent feature, especially for those looking to save space in smaller homes and apartments.

Other benefits include the ability to stream your favourite shows and films on its tablet shelf, which is slightly larger than the treadmills of other brands'. The console's USB port can be used to charge and store your devices. If you prefer not to use the tablet holder, you can queue up movies or sitcoms using the treadmill's built-in speakers.
